Technical Problem

The existing magnetic levitation pumps have a long axial length due to the need for separate axial lengths for screwing the impeller and inserting the lid portion, leading to a risk of tilting and contact between the rotating body and the housing.

Method used

The magnetic levitation pump design includes a lid portion with a mounting portion on its outer circumference that is inserted into and attached to the cylindrical portion, and an impeller with a screw hole formed radially inward, allowing the lid to be shortened axially, and the impeller to be detachably attached, thereby reducing the overall axial length.

Benefits of technology

The design results in a more compact rotating body, reducing the risk of tilting and contact with the housing, while enabling easy replacement of components like the rotor and rotating magnetic parts.

Abstract

The present invention provides a magnetic levitation pump that allows for a compact configuration of the rotating body in the axial direction. [Solution] The magnetic levitation pump of the present disclosure comprises a housing having an inlet and an outlet for a fluid to be transferred; a rotating body disposed within the housing, having a cylindrical portion rotatable around an axis and a lid portion that closes an opening on one axial side of the cylindrical portion; a magnetic bearing having a fixed magnetic portion provided in the housing and a rotating magnetic portion provided on the rotating body opposite the fixed magnetic portion, which supports the rotating body in a non-contact manner by magnetic repulsion force generated between the fixed magnetic portion and the rotating magnetic portion; and an impeller provided on the lid portion within the housing, wherein the lid portion has a mounting portion on its outer circumference that is inserted into and attached to the cylindrical portion, and a screw hole opening on one axial side is formed radially inward from the outer circumference of the lid portion, and the impeller has a first male screw that is screwed into the screw hole of the lid portion.
